Alterity Investments Buys Prime Uxbridge Property

April 29, 2015

Alterity Investments, advised by Green & Partners, has purchased the freehold investment of 21/23 High Street, Uxbridge for £3.8 million, reflecting a net initial yield of 5%.

Located directly opposite Intu Uxbridge and within close proximity to the Underground station, the 7,430 sq ft property is let to Lloyds Bank Plc on a 10 year FR&I lease from June 2014 and generates an annual income of £200,000 pa.

BNP Paribas Real Estate represented the vendor, LFD Group.
